Frequently Asked Questions About Insurance in Somerville

What are the minimum auto insurance requirements for drivers in Somerville, MA?

In Somerville, Massachusetts, drivers must carry liability insurance with minimum limits of $20,000 per person for bodily injury, $40,000 per accident for bodily injury, and $5,000 for property damage. Additionally, Massachusetts requires Personal Injury Protection (PIP) coverage of at least $8,000 per person and uninsured motorist coverage matching your liability limits.

How does Somerville's dense urban environment affect my home insurance premiums?

Somerville's high population density and older housing stock can lead to higher home insurance premiums due to increased risks of theft, vandalism, and fire spread between closely spaced properties. Additionally, older homes may require specific endorsements for outdated electrical or plumbing systems, which can further increase costs.

Are there specific flood insurance considerations for Somerville residents?

Yes, parts of Somerville near the Mystic River and Alewife Brook are in flood-prone areas, making flood insurance highly recommended even if not federally required. Standard home insurance policies don't cover flood damage, so residents should consider purchasing separate flood insurance through the National Flood Insurance Program or private insurers.

What health insurance options are available for Somerville's diverse population?

Somerville residents can access health insurance through Massachusetts' Health Connector, which offers subsidized plans for qualifying individuals and families. The city's diverse population, including many students and low-income residents, may also qualify for MassHealth (Medicaid) or Commonwealth Care programs, providing affordable coverage options.

How does parking in Somerville affect auto insurance rates and coverage needs?

Street parking in Somerville's crowded neighborhoods increases the risk of auto theft, vandalism, and collision damage from other vehicles, which can lead to higher comprehensive and collision insurance premiums. Residents should consider these coverages despite the additional cost, as the city's limited off-street parking options make vehicles more vulnerable to damage.

Why Independent Insurance Agents in Somerville, MA Are Your Best Local Resource

Navigating the world of insurance in Somerville, Massachusetts, can feel overwhelming, especially with the city's unique blend of historic triple-deckers, bustling commercial corridors like Davis Square, and a diverse population of students, young professionals, and long-time residents. This is where the value of independent insurance agents in Somerville truly shines. Unlike captive agents who represent a single company, independent agents work with multiple insurance carriers. This means they can shop the market on your behalf to find coverage that not only fits your budget but is also tailored to the specific risks of living in Somerville. For instance, they understand the importance of comprehensive renters insurance for the large student population near Tufts and the need for robust homeowners policies that account for older home systems and the potential for weather-related damage from New England storms. An independent insurance agent acts as your personal advocate, offering choice and localized expertise that a direct online purchase simply cannot match. One of the most significant advantages of partnering with independent insurance agents in Somerville is their deep understanding of Massachusetts' specific insurance regulations and requirements. From the complexities of auto insurance in a densely populated area with challenging street parking to the nuances of Massachusetts' health insurance mandates, a local independent agent is your guide. They can explain how factors like Somerville's high pedestrian traffic or your daily commute into Boston might affect your auto premiums and help you find discounts you may qualify for, such as those for bundling policies or having a clean driving record. Their office is often just a short walk or bike ride away in Union Square or East Somerville, making in-person consultations convenient and fostering a genuine community relationship. When it comes to making a claim, having a local independent agent by your side is invaluable. Imagine a pipe bursts in your Winter Hill apartment or a fallen limb damages your car parked on a narrow Somerville street. Your independent agent knows the local adjusters and can navigate the claims process efficiently, advocating for a fair and timely resolution. They provide a human touch and continuity of service that large, impersonal call centers lack. For Somerville residents seeking truly personalized protection, the path forward is clear.
